Output 86e368c8e7ba593a646e7415ac7b2620888d66df7c6c5204e6b504992dae6b6a:1

value
132684
script pubkey
OP_0 OP_PUSHBYTES_20 a8dc695c089b6d93f715cdc31fe03f93a9f338e4
address
bc1q4rwxjhqgndke8ac4ehp3lcpljw5lxw8yf7v3ct
transaction
86e368c8e7ba593a646e7415ac7b2620888d66df7c6c5204e6b504992dae6b6a
spent
true